The 031-70237: Rated to 3 GHz maximum frequency with a 0.2 dB insertion loss, this plug suits 75 Ohm video, broadcast, and data-signal paths where signal integrity matters up into the low microwave range.

It remains available through the independent distribution channel for existing BOM lines, but new projects should select a current-production 75 Ohm BNC plug from the Amphenol RF catalogue. No official direct-replacement order code is listed; sourcing is per RFQ against the remaining factory and distributor inventory.

Termination Checklist — Crimp, Don't Solder

The kit includes one contact and one ferrule — order additional kits for multi-position runs. The centre contact crimps onto the signal conductor; the ferrule crimps over the braid and jacket. No soldering iron needed, which speeds field installation and avoids heat damage to the PTFE dielectric. Mates with any standard 75 Ohm BNC jack (female) with a bayonet lock.

What cable does 031-70237 work with?

The 031-70237 is specified for AT&T 735, 735A, and Belden 735A1 cable groups. The included ferrule and contact are sized for the jacket diameter and centre conductor of those cables.
